PRO-LAB
Motivation
PRO-LAB addresses the rising energy demands of computationally intensive AI applications, which can consume up to 20 times more electricity under load than in idle mode. With the existing Green-IT-Housing-Center and photovoltaic installations serving as infrastructure, the project provides an ideal foundation for developing methods to operate AI training processes as energy-efficiently as possible. This approach combines technological innovation with ecological responsibility and strengthens regional competitiveness through forward-looking research.

Objective
The project aims to develop an intelligent, energy-efficient control system for AI systems that integrates energy data, building data from cooling and ventilation systems, and weather information. Based on this data, algorithms will be created to dynamically and efficiently distribute AI workloads, particularly when renewable energy supply exceeds demand. To achieve this, a modern data and computing infrastructure will be established and analyzed within the context of the interdisciplinary energy research laboratory. The ultimate goal is the development of intelligent task distribution to prevent peak loads. This solution is intended to serve as a foundation for reducing energy consumption, lowering CO₂ emissions, and enhancing the efficiency of computing infrastructure, thereby contributing to the climate goals of the federal state of Bremen.
Approach
Data will be centrally collected, processed, and analyzed in real time to optimally plan AI training processes. The system will consider not only energy demand but also the thermal load on the computing infrastructure. The developed approaches will be tested in a laboratory environment and validated using measured data.
